PDJN turning tool holder

A PDJN turning tool holder is an external turning tool holder designed for machining operations on lathes. It securely holds a diamond-shaped insert with a 55-degree point angle (D type) and is often used for profiling and general turning applications due to its versatility and ease of use. Choosing the right PDJN turning tool holder is crucial for achieving optimal machining performance and precision.Understanding PDJN Turning Tool HoldersWhat is a PDJN Turning Tool Holder?A PDJN turning tool holder is a type of external turning tool holder used on lathes. The 'PDJN' designation refers to the specific ISO nomenclature for this type of holder. It's designed to hold a 'D' style insert (diamond shape with a 55-degree angle). The holder's design allows for efficient chip evacuation and provides good accessibility to the workpiece.Key Features of PDJN Holders Insert Shape: Designed for 'D' style diamond inserts with a 55-degree point. Application: Primarily used for external turning and profiling operations. Orientation: Typically used for right-hand cutting. Clamping Mechanism: Lever lock or screw clamp for secure insert holding. Material: Made from high-quality alloy steel for rigidity and durability.Selecting the Right PDJN Turning Tool HolderFactors to ConsiderChoosing the appropriate PDJN turning tool holder depends on several factors, including: Machine Type: Ensure compatibility with your lathe's tool holding system. Workpiece Material: Different materials require different cutting parameters and insert geometries. Operation Type: Profiling, roughing, or finishing operations demand specific holder and insert characteristics. Insert Size: The size of the insert determines the depth of cut and feed rate. Shank Size: Match the shank size to your lathe's tool post. A too-small holder may vibrate, while an overly large holder can limit clearance. Consider these dimensions: Shank Height & Width: Match to your tool post. Overall Length: Ensure sufficient reach for your typical workpiece size. Insert Size Designation: Select based on required cutting depth and material removal rate.PDJN Turning Tool Holder ApplicationsCommon Machining OperationsPDJN turning tool holders are versatile and suitable for a range of turning operations, including: External Turning: Reducing the diameter of a workpiece. Profiling: Creating complex shapes and contours. Facing: Machining the end of a workpiece to create a flat surface. Chamfering: Creating a beveled edge.Material ConsiderationsThe workpiece material significantly impacts the choice of insert grade and cutting parameters. Here's a brief overview: Steel: Use carbide inserts with appropriate coatings for steel machining. Stainless Steel: Opt for inserts with good edge toughness and wear resistance. Aluminum: Use uncoated carbide or high-speed steel inserts with sharp cutting edges. Cast Iron: Consider ceramic or cermet inserts for high-speed machining.PDJN Turning Tool Holder InsertsUnderstanding Insert Grades and GeometriesThe insert is the cutting element of the tool holder, and selecting the right insert is crucial for achieving optimal performance. Inserts are available in various grades (carbide, ceramic, cermet, etc.) and geometries (chip breakers, nose radii, etc.).Common Insert Types for PDJN HoldersSince PDJN turning tool holders use 'D' style inserts, here are some common insert types: DCMT: Diamond-shaped insert with a clearance angle. DCGT: Diamond-shaped insert with a ground periphery. DC** inserts Various chip breaker options are available for these diamond inserts, such as DM, DR, or DS, depending on the manufacturer and specific application.Benefits of Using a PDJN Turning Tool HolderAdvantages Over Other Tool HoldersPDJN turning tool holders offer several advantages: Versatility: Suitable for a wide range of turning operations. Accessibility: The design allows for good access to the workpiece. Chip Evacuation: Efficient chip removal prevents re-cutting and improves surface finish. Ease of Use: Simple clamping mechanism for quick insert changes. Cost-Effective: Relatively inexpensive compared to other specialized tool holders.Troubleshooting Common IssuesVibration and ChatterVibration and chatter can negatively impact surface finish and tool life. Here are some troubleshooting tips: Increase Cutting Speed: Higher cutting speeds can sometimes reduce vibration. Reduce Feed Rate: Lower feed rates can improve stability. Use a Sharp Insert: A worn insert can contribute to vibration. Ensure Proper Clamping: Make sure the insert is securely clamped in the holder. Reduce Overhang: Minimize the distance the tool holder extends from the tool post.Poor Surface FinishA poor surface finish can be caused by several factors: Worn Insert: Replace the insert with a new one. Incorrect Cutting Parameters: Adjust cutting speed, feed rate, and depth of cut. Inadequate Coolant: Ensure sufficient coolant flow to the cutting zone. Material Build-up: Use an insert with a suitable chip breaker to prevent material build-up on the cutting edge.Maintenance and CareProper Cleaning and StorageProper maintenance is essential for extending the life of your PDJN turning tool holder: Clean Regularly: Remove chips and debris after each use. Lubricate Moving Parts: Apply a light oil to the clamping mechanism. Store Properly: Store the tool holder in a dry and protected environment.Where to Buy PDJN Turning Tool HoldersYou can purchase PDJN turning tool holders from various sources, including: Online Retailers: Websites specializing in cutting tools and machine tool accessories.
